ALMONTE TALLIES TWICE IN,
19-3, LOSS
TO WESTFIELD STATE
|
|
|
Westfield, MA—Sophomore
attack Suany Almonte (Warwick, RI) scored two of RIC's three
goals in a 19-3 loss at Westfield State in collegiate women's
lacrosse action on Thursday night. |

Westfield
State sophomore Laura Chiricosta had six goals and three
assists, while sophomore Rachel Dionne scored four goals to
lead the Owls. |
|
|
|
|
|
The
victory was the sixth straight for the Owls, who boosted their
record to 7-1. Rhode Island College drops to 1-6. |
|
|
|
|
|
Westfield
scored six goals in the fist eight minutes - three by Chiricosta and
two from senior Kasey Rogers - to jump out to a 6-0 lead. The
Owls led at halftime, 15-3. |
|
|
|
|
|
Rogers
tallied three goals and junior Ally Brown had two goals
and two assists. Also scoring two goals was freshman Jen Lyon. |
|
|
|
|
|
In upcoming action, Rhode Island
College will resume Little East Conference play at Keene State on
Saturday, Apr. 4. |
